在互聯(lián)網(wǎng)時(shí)代,安全、可信的網(wǎng)絡(luò)連接對(duì)于任何在線業(yè)務(wù)都至關(guān)重要,SSL(Secure Sockets Layer)證書是一種加密技術(shù),用于保護(hù)用戶的隱私和數(shù)據(jù)安全,它確保了信息在網(wǎng)絡(luò)傳輸過程中不會(huì)被竊取或篡改。
以下是關(guān)于如何為你的網(wǎng)站添加SSL證書的步驟:
確定需要的SSL證書類型
你需要確定你所需要的SSL證書類型,根據(jù)你的需求,可以分為以下幾種:
- 單域名SSL證書:適用于一個(gè)獨(dú)立的網(wǎng)站。
- 多域名SSL證書:適用于多個(gè)相關(guān)的網(wǎng)站或子域。
- 全通配符SSL證書:適用于多個(gè)不完全相同的域名。
選擇合適的SSL證書類型取決于你的具體需求和安全要求。
下載適合的SSL證書文件
一旦確定了所需類型的SSL證書后,下一步就是下載相應(yīng)的證書文件,這些文件通常以 .crt
或 .pem
格式存在,你可以從SSL證書供應(yīng)商的官方網(wǎng)站上獲取這些文件。
將SSL證書上傳至服務(wù)器
將SSL證書上傳到你的網(wǎng)站服務(wù)器,這步通常由你的主機(jī)提供商來完成,大多數(shù)主機(jī)提供商提供了簡單的管理控制面板,讓你能夠輕松地上傳SSL證書,在控制面板中,導(dǎo)航到“SSL設(shè)置”、“證書管理”或類似選項(xiàng),然后按照指示上傳你剛剛下載的SSL證書文件,有些平臺(tái)可能還需要你提供私鑰文件,這是為了進(jìn)一步加強(qiáng)安全性,請(qǐng)確保私鑰文件的安全,不要輕易泄露給任何人。
配置網(wǎng)站以使用SSL證書
上傳SSL證書之后,你的網(wǎng)站需要配置以使用它們,這通常是通過更改服務(wù)器上的 HTTP 頭和 URL 終點(diǎn)來實(shí)現(xiàn)的,不同的 Web 服務(wù)器軟件有不同的方法來實(shí)現(xiàn)這一點(diǎn)。
如果你正在使用 Apache Web 服務(wù)器,可以在站點(diǎn)根目錄下創(chuàng)建一個(gè)名為 cert.pem
的文件,并在其中包含你的 SSL 證書和私鑰,在服務(wù)器配置文件(如 /etc/apache2/sites-available/000-default.conf
)中,加入以下代碼段:
<VirtualHost *:80> ServerName yourdomain.com Redirect permanent / https://yourdomain.com/ </VirtualHost> <VirtualHost *:443> DocumentRoot /var/www/html SSLEngine on SSLCertificateFile /path/to/cert.pem SSLCertificateKeyFile /path/to/privatekey.pem </VirtualHost>
將上述代碼替換為你自己的路徑和名稱。
測(cè)試SSL證書的有效性
測(cè)試 SSL 證書是否正確安裝并生效,打開你的瀏覽器,訪問你的網(wǎng)站,檢查地址欄中的 URL 是否顯示為 https://
而不是 http://
,如果一切正常,說明 SSL 證書已經(jīng)成功安裝并且有效。
添加 SSL 證書到你的網(wǎng)站是一個(gè)相對(duì)簡單的過程,但確保所有步驟都遵循正確的流程是非常重要的,錯(cuò)誤的操作可能會(huì)導(dǎo)致用戶看到錯(cuò)誤的警告消息,從而影響用戶體驗(yàn),如果你不確定如何操作,建議聯(lián)系你的網(wǎng)站托管服務(wù)提供商尋求幫助。